Star Wars Squadrons free update adds two new Starfighters

By Stephany Nunneley, Saturday, 12 December 2020 14:20 GMT Star Wars Squadrons update 4.0 has been deployed.The December update for Star Wars Squadrons is live, and it not only includes bug fixes but two new Starfighters.These starfighters feature one for the New Republic and the Galactic Empire. The New Republic gets the B-wing Starfighter and the Galactic Empire receives the TIE/d “Defender” multi-role Starfighter.The B-wing is categorized as a Bomber-class Starfighter and the TIE defender is a Fighter.With the update also comes custom matches which will allow one to five players per side across two teams to play on any maps…

Don’t expect post-launch content for Star Wars: Squadrons

It looks like whatever content Star Wars: Squadrons released with will be all that it ever gets.EA doesn’t appear to have long-term plans for Star Wars: Squadrons. The publisher revealed that the budget-priced space shooter will not receive post-launch support standard with most games these days.Speaking to Upload VR, creative director Ian Frazier confirmed that what’s there right now is likely all we’re getting, as Squadrons wasn’t designed as a service game.“Never say never, so to speak, but as far as our philosophy goes we’re not trying to treat the game as a live service,” said Frazier. “We don’t want…
